About the role
We are looking for a dynamic and enthusiastic individual in the UK who can support the day to day sales and distribution of Practical Action Publishing’s commercial product lists as Publishing Sales & Distribution Assistant. You will be part of a small specialist publishing company, which is an integral part of the wider Practical Action organisation and will help us drive publishing impact and content delivery.
In this role you will undertake most of the day to day responsibility for sales and distribution activities; helping the publishing team to deliver that work to agreed budget, schedule and quality. You will also provide support to editorial and marketing areas of the business when required.
Tasks may include: Stock monitoring and product ordering; online sales order processing, dispatch and returns; occasional editorial support including assisting with the Print on Demand programme; occasional marketing support including market research and analytics; maintaining relationships with wholesalers, suppliers and customers; from time to time you might be required to offer logistical support for book launches and conferences.
Critical to the success of the role will be the ability to engage, communicate, and build relationships with customers, distributors and suppliers.

About us
We are an independent publishing company and an integral part of an international development organisation, Practical Action, putting ingenious ideas to work so people in poverty can change their world. We share what works with others, so answers that start small can grow big.
Practical Action is a global change-making group. The group consists of a UK registered charity with community projects in Africa, Asia and Latin America, an independent development publishing company and a technical consulting service. We combine these specialisms to multiply our impact and help shape a world that works better for everyone.
